This is NOT the typical output voltage wave-
form. Note the increased “ripple” in the out-
put waveform. The output capacitors were
disconnected to simulate a faulty capacitor
bank. Note that each vertical division repre-
sents 20 volts and each horizontal division
represents 5 milliseconds in time.

Note: Scope probes connected at machine
high inductance output terminals.

Volts/Div .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. .20 V/Div.

Horizontal Sweep . . . . . . . . . .5 ms/Div.

Coupling .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. .DC.

Trigger .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. .Internal.

SCOPE SETTINGS

MACHINE LOADED TO 300 AMPS AT 32 VDC

ABNORMAL OUTPUT WELD VOLTAGE WAVEFORM - MACHINE LOADED

CAPACITOR BANK NOT FUNCTIONING
